Running Mobil1 in everything.
'02 Camry V6 has 140K, '93 Corona SF has 135K, both run Mobil1 5W50 as recommended by Mobil with 10K Oil & Filter changes, and I buy 20l at a time from the Mobil Distributor which works out ~$12.00 per litre. Honda motorcycle has 192K running Mobil1 Race4T with 6K oil & Filter changes.
None of the engines use enough oil to register on the dipstick between changes.
Best oil ever made IMO.

Recommend brake pads for 2003 Camry Sportivo
in Camry Club
Posted
Dunno if you've noticed that they 'rock' race machinery after it has come in. Reason is that very hot brake disks have part of the disk covered by the pad assembly which causes the disk to cool unevenly causing warping. After a hard stop or two let the car roll a metre or so every now and again for the few minutes to allow the disks to cool evenly.
